Newhouse Road is in Stoke-On-Trent and in Stoke-On-Trent district. ST2 8BL is located in the Abbey Hulton elect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Stoke-on-Trent Central.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Newhouse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Newhouse Road was 75.1 per 1,000 residents, which is 30.2% lower than the Abbey Hulton average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Newhouse Road has the 10th lowest crime rate of 24 local areas in Abbey Hulton and the 352nd lowest crime rate of 844 local areas in Stoke-on-Trent .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 42.0 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-10.3%.
